Amid the vibrant setting of the 2025 Legislators Forum for Friendly Exchanges in Xinjiang, Edin Djerlek, vice president of Serbia’s National Assembly and deputy president of the Justice and Reconciliation Party, shared his insights as one of the event’s highest-ranking delegates. Following a keynote address and a special visit to Ili with fellow international lawmakers, he offered a powerful testimony of his experience.
During his tour of Xinjiang’s factories and enterprises, Djerlek witnessed firsthand the region’s remarkable strides in high-quality development. He praised not only Xinjiang’s economic vitality but also its role as a crucial bridge in the Belt and Road Initiative, linking Serbia and China with broader Central and Eastern European cooperation.
